AcSDKP ELISA Kits
N-acetyl-seryl-aspartyl-lysyl-proline (AcSDKP) is an endogenous tetrapeptide that plays a significant role in hematopoiesis by regulating the proliferation of hematopoietic stem cells. It is also involved in cardiovascular physiology and has been studied for its potential therapeutic applications. AcSDKP is primarily degraded by angiotensin-converting enzyme (ACE), making its measurement valuable in research related to ACE inhibition and associated physiological processes.

Applications:
- Cardiovascular Research: AcSDKP is involved in cardiovascular physiology, and its levels are influenced by ACE activity. Measuring AcSDKP can provide insights into the effects of ACE inhibitors and the regulation of blood pressure.
- Hematopoiesis Studies: Due to its role in regulating hematopoietic stem cell proliferation, AcSDKP measurement is valuable in studies of bone marrow function and disorders.
- Pharmacological Research: Evaluating the impact of drugs, particularly ACE inhibitors, on AcSDKP levels can help understand their mechanisms and therapeutic effects.
